Predictors and Clinical Significance of Myocardial Injury in Elderly Patients Under the COVID-19 Pandemic
Description
CONCLUSION: Myocardial injury was a common phenomenon and prognostic predictor in elder patients after SARS-CoV-2 infection. Higher threshold of myocardial injury may be considered to improve risk stratification.
In vitro effect of hydroxyethyl starch on COVID-19 patients-associated hypofibrinolytic state
Description
CONCLUSION: These results highlight that HES increased apparent in vitro tPA-induced fibrinolysis in case of severe COVID-19 disease. Use of this plasma volume expander may translate as a potential help against COVID-19-induced thrombosis occurrence.
